Broken Key Removal
It's always a horrible experience to have a broken key. It can happen at the worst possible time. Your car key may snap into the lock cylinder when you are loading groceries into the car, at a traffic light or while you are driving to work. It can be a frustrating and costly experience, particularly when you need to hire a locksmith to replace the lock cylinder. To minimize this problem it is crucial to handle keys with care and check them regularly for wear and tear, to avoid putting too much force when turning the key inside the lock, and also to ensure they are in good condition.
Due to the constant use and frequent insertions and detachments, traditional car ignition keys are subjected to a lot of strain. This can result in the ignition key to weaken and eventually snap off or break in the cylinder. Keys that snap can be very difficult to remove, and attempting to do this could cause further damage to the lock or ignition. It is best to call a licensed locksmith who has the equipment and expertise to take out the broken key without causing any further damage to the lock or ignition.
If you aren't able to wait for a car locksmith There are a few DIY methods you can try at home to try to pull your broken key out of the lock without further harming it. If you own a pair of needle-nose pliers, spray some WD-40 or an equivalent lubricant in the key hole and carefully grasp the visible portion of the broken key with the pliers to lift it out. This isn't an easy process, but it's a good way to remove a broken car key from the lock without causing damage to it further.
It's tempting when you're in a rush, to use a bobby-pin or safety pin, a paper clip, or any other small object to take your car key from the lock. However this is a risky method that can cause further damage to the lock and could result in more money to repair or replace it. Contacting a professional locksmith that offers an emergency auto-lock services is the quickest and most secure method of removing a damaged key from the lock.

Key Fob Battery Issues
A dead battery on the keyfob is among the most frequent causes of car lock malfunction. A dead battery in the key fob can cause it to stop sending signals to your vehicle. A quick replacement can restore functionality.
It could be that the key fob itself is faulty. The locksmith can connect the key fob to a computer to determine whether it is sending an alert to your car key repair service. If the problem lies somewhere else, the locksmith can replace the key fob for you.
Another problem that can arise is when your key gets stuck in the lock. This could result from many factors which range from extreme cold to dirt accumulation inside the lock. You could damage the lock mechanism if trying to force out the key. Instead, leave it to a professional and they can get the key out without damaging your car lock or trunk latch.

Key Copy & Replacement
A spare key on hand is always an excellent idea. It will prevent you from getting locked out or needing to call locksmith assistance in the event of an emergency. Many people store their spare keys under the doormat or in pots near the front door. This makes them easy to lose and can make your home vulnerable. If you cannot find your spare key, or if it's lost or stolen the key could be copied to give you access to your vehicle.
Big-box stores and hardware stores usually offer a key-copying service. Stop by and select a new key in the same design as your worn out one and have it cut right there and then. The process takes just some minutes. You can also stop by an online service such as KeyMe which has a nationwide network of kiosks that make a basic copy of your key right on the spot.
If you require keys with high security it is recommended to go to the local dealer instead of the hardware store. A lot of newer vehicles have transponder chips in the key fob, which cannot be duplicated using a conventional key cutter. Dealers can create keys for you as provided you have proof of ownership, such a registration or title document.
You can also obtain a duplicate of your key from a convenience or drug retailer that sells auto accessories. Some of these stores have key duplication equipment that can create an exact copy of your existing key for around $10.
